What do you do for a lip infection?

For a lip infection, you can try applying a warm compress to help reduce swelling and discomfort. You can also apply an over-the-counter antiseptic ointment to the affected area to help prevent infection. If the infection does not improve or gets worse, it's best to see a healthcare professional for further treatment.

Can you get an infection on your lips by using lip balm?

Yes. You can get an infection on your lips by using a contaminated lip balm or if you share makeup with somebody who has something. For example, If that person has a disease like the herpes simplex virus (that causes cold sores), you will be infected with it.
